Модераторы: Daevaorn

Поиск:

Закрытая темаСоздание новой темы Создание опроса
> С чего начать изучать С/С++? 
:(
    Опции темы
Елена
  Дата 29.12.2002, 08:18 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 7
Регистрация: 29.12.2002
Где: Ieper

Репутация: нет
Всего: нет



Всех с наступающими праздниками!

Здравствуйте.
Я - самый настоящий чайник и даже хуже того!
Пожалуйста посоветуйте какой учебник мне преобрести, где, как только можно проще, описываются самые первые шаги в С/С++, то есть самые азы.
Спасибо заранее.
:sarcasm
PM MAIL MSN   Вверх
Klin
Дата 29.12.2002, 16:15 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
***


Профиль
Группа: Участник Клуба
Сообщений: 1938
Регистрация: 7.10.2002
Где: Краснодар

Репутация: нет
Всего: 25



Если Borland C + + Builder, то для чайников такая есть(сам с неё начинал) "Занимательное программирование С + +", авторы С. Симонович, Г. Евсеев.


--------------------
Я человек - попробуйте обвинить меня за это.
PM MAIL   Вверх
Fantasist
Дата 29.12.2002, 16:38 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Лентяй
***


Профиль
Группа: Участник Клуба
Сообщений: 1517
Регистрация: 24.3.2002

Репутация: 4
Всего: 41



Да для чайников книг хоть отбавляй. :) Можешь брать почти любую.


--------------------
Волны гасят ветер...
PM MAIL   Вверх
Step
Дата 29.12.2002, 19:49 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
****


Профиль
Группа: Экс. модератор
Сообщений: 5151
Регистрация: 26.9.2002
Где: дурдом.UA

Репутация: 5
Всего: 25



сайт firststep, точного адреса не помню


--------------------
- Дурак учится на своих ошибках, умный на чужих.
 - умные учатся у дураков
PM MAIL ICQ   Вверх
DrMasik
Дата 29.12.2002, 21:22 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 35
Регистрация: 13.12.2002

Репутация: нет
Всего: нет



Елена, во-первых, возникает вопрос: "На каком уровне ты хо знать его?"
Если читсо так - для себя - тогда бери книку любую, какую увидишь на раскладке. Если же для будущего, тогда найди в сетке(интернете) учителя, который поставит тя на путь истенный. Сама ты можешь не в те степи пойти и потратишь только зря время. К тому же некоторые вещи не пишут в книгах так ясно, как того хотелось бы. Так что мой те совет - найди такого человека! Они есть. но их сразу не видно...
Что же касается литературы, то классическим способоя есть - Бьерн Страуструп, Герберд Шилд(как по мне) ну а потом уже сама поймешь...
PM MAIL ICQ   Вверх
AntonSaburov
Дата 29.12.2002, 23:35 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Штурман
****


Профиль
Группа: Модератор
Сообщений: 5658
Регистрация: 2.7.2002
Где: Санкт-Петербург

Репутация: нет
Всего: 118



Самое главное - иметь доступ компьютеру, на котором установлен компилятор С/С++. Нужно в первую очередь научится делать самый главный цикл в программировании
- редактирование файла
- компиляция файла
- запуск файла

Как только получится этот цикл, дальше можно брать любую книжку.
PM MAIL WWW ICQ   Вверх
Step
Дата 30.12.2002, 00:45 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
****


Профиль
Группа: Экс. модератор
Сообщений: 5151
Регистрация: 26.9.2002
Где: дурдом.UA

Репутация: 5
Всего: 25



а также знать,
конструкции,
типы данных,
указатели(распределение памяти),
циклы,
масивы,
условия,

Это основное, все остальное делается через перечисленное.


--------------------
- Дурак учится на своих ошибках, умный на чужих.
 - умные учатся у дураков
PM MAIL ICQ   Вверх
Klin
  Дата 30.12.2002, 01:12 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
***


Профиль
Группа: Участник Клуба
Сообщений: 1938
Регистрация: 7.10.2002
Где: Краснодар

Репутация: нет
Всего: 25



Цитата(Step @ 29.12.2002, 11:49)
точного адреса не помню

http://www.firststeps.ru, помойму.




--------------------
Я человек - попробуйте обвинить меня за это.
PM MAIL   Вверх
Елена
Дата 30.12.2002, 01:49 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 7
Регистрация: 29.12.2002
Где: Ieper

Репутация: нет
Всего: нет



Большое всем спасибо за отзывчивость.

Я уже заказала по инету следующие книги:

1) C++ Специальный справочник (Борис Карпов).
2) Язык программирования C++ (Бьерн Страуструп).
3) Как программировать на C++ (Х.М. Дейтел , П.Дж. Дейтел).
4) Borland C++ 5 (Киммел П.).
5) Самоучитель C++ 3 издание (Герберт Шилдт).
Теперь осталось только дождаться. :rolleyes Но до того времени, пока не пришли мои книги, уж простите меня Бога ради, я буду вам надоедать своими примитивными вопросами. :sarcasm

Я вчера пробовала установить Borland C++ v5.5. Инстальнула, после чего у меня на диске C:\ появилась папка Borland. Только что с ней делать дальше, я не знаю. :butbut  Я так понимаю что это компилятор.  
Поясните пожалуйста как им пользоваться.

У меня есть диск "Научись сам 2001 программировать на С/С++". На нём имеется следующее:

1)  Borland C++ v 5.5
2)  Borland C++ v5.02
3)  SuperH RISC Engine CPP v5.1B R1 with HEW v 1.1A
4)  Development Assistant for C v3.5.568
5)  Zotech C and C++ v3.1
6)  Borland C++v3.1 for DOS
7)  Microsoft Visual C++ v6.0
8)  SP4 Watcom C++ SE
9)  Direct Sound v3.0
10) FTP Client Engine Library for C and C++
11) SMTP and POP3 email
12) Engine for C/C++
13) TurboC v2.0
14) Visual Parse PP v4.0
15) WithClass 99

С чего из перечисленного списка лучше всего начать изучение С, С++, Visual C++ или TurboC? И чем они отличаются?
При ответе пожалуйста имейте ввиду, что меня не интересует рисование как на Visual C++.
Я уже пробовала по учебнику Visual C++ из инета, но там описывается как рисовать диалоговые окна, и отсюда возникает вопрос вдогонку:
Если я программирую на Visual C++, значит ли это, что я всегда должна программировать только по шаблонам? :sneaky2

Мой парень изучает Perl и помогает мне чем может: объясняет терминологию, принцип работы программиста и сказал, что появившаяся папка напоминает Perl интерпритатор. Но тем не менее, имеется масса вопросов на которые он, к сожалению, ответить не может.
Поэтому я думаю, что здесь надолго.
Он посоветовал мне изучать именно СЮШУ  и, кстати, желает вам всем удачи в ремесле программиста. :cool

Заранее благодарна,
Елена
PM MAIL MSN   Вверх
Елена
Дата 30.12.2002, 02:04 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 7
Регистрация: 29.12.2002
Где: Ieper

Репутация: нет
Всего: нет



For DrMasik

Я хочу знать один язык, в данном сдучае C, C++, но до профессионализма. Короче, все языки где есть буква "С", причём неважно сколько там плюсов, Visual или Turbo.  :bored
Вообще-то я всегда специализировалась на иностраннных языках, но глядя на то, как программирование по-уши поглотило моего парня, который спит по 4 часа в сутки, решила тоже начать это нелёгкое дело.  :inlove

Так с чего же, всё-таки начать? :huh

Удачи.
PM MAIL MSN   Вверх
Step
Дата 30.12.2002, 02:41 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
****


Профиль
Группа: Экс. модератор
Сообщений: 5151
Регистрация: 26.9.2002
Где: дурдом.UA

Репутация: 5
Всего: 25



ох ну ты и погорячилась


--------------------
- Дурак учится на своих ошибках, умный на чужих.
 - умные учатся у дураков
PM MAIL ICQ   Вверх
DrMasik
Дата 30.12.2002, 04:21 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 35
Регистрация: 13.12.2002

Репутация: нет
Всего: нет



Ну чо же... Ты хочешь что-то знпать - это чудненько. Я в инете с 22:00 до 00:00 каждый день. На выходных - хаотично... Так что если будут вопросики - обращайся - помагу чам смогу. Моя аська
79267893
Зайди на
www.icq.com
Там все расскажут... На Английском, но это мелочи, я так думаю...
PM MAIL ICQ   Вверх
Dagger
Дата 30.12.2002, 09:45 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Экс. модератор
Сообщений: 377
Регистрация: 4.9.2002
Где: Киев

Репутация: нет
Всего: 8



Привет, Лена :)
На мой взгляд надо определиться что изучать - С или С++ т.к. эти языки хоть и синтаксисом почти идентичны, но, так уж исторически сложилось, что в первом нет классов и еще много чего, что присутствует во втором. В С++ всяких фишек стандартный полно, чего нет в С. Уверен, что ты получишь мало удовольствия от сношения с указателями и типом char... вроде-как пишу на ANSI C и знаю о чем говорю.

Оффтоп: Макс, а ты, блин, скромняга :D


PM MAIL WWW Skype   Вверх
Елена
Дата 30.12.2002, 11:37 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 7
Регистрация: 29.12.2002
Где: Ieper

Репутация: нет
Всего: нет



Уважаемые люди ответившие на мой зов о помощи,
огромное спасибо за помощь.
Я обязательно воспользуюсь вашими советами.

Ещё раз всех с Новым годом!
Желаю вдохновения и новых открытий!

Елена
:thumbs-up
PM MAIL MSN   Вверх
Dagger
  Дата 30.12.2002, 12:03 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Экс. модератор
Сообщений: 377
Регистрация: 4.9.2002
Где: Киев

Репутация: нет
Всего: 8



Большой и жирный оффтоп!

Всех с наступающем:). Дабы изучение или практика С или С++ в году грядущем была приятной и полезной!

Пейте по здоровью :D

Свято наближається!!! :exclamation
PM MAIL WWW Skype   Вверх
Страницы: (3) Все [1] 2 3 
Закрытая темаСоздание новой темы Создание опроса
Правила форума "С++:Общие вопросы"
Earnest Daevaorn

Добро пожаловать!

  • Черновик стандарта C++ (за октябрь 2005) можно скачать с этого сайта. Прямая ссылка на файл черновика(4.4мб).
  • Черновик стандарта C (за сентябрь 2005) можно скачать с этого сайта. Прямая ссылка на файл черновика (3.4мб).
  • Прежде чем задать вопрос, прочтите это и/или это!
  • Здесь хранится весь мировой запас ссылок на документы, связанные с C++ :)
  • Не брезгуйте пользоваться тегами [code=cpp][/code].
  • Пожалуйста, не просите написать за вас программы в этом разделе - для этого существует "Центр Помощи".
  • C++ FAQ

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Earnest Daevaorn

 
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| C/C++: Общие вопросы | Следующая тема »


 




[ Время генерации скрипта: 0.0965 ]   [ Использовано запросов: 22 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.